A five-weight geometric sans by Yanik Hauschild that alternates soft curves with sharp straight lines and leans heavily on alternate glyphs for typographic variety.
About
Designed by Yanik Hauschild and published by Nice To Type in 2019, Blow runs from Thin to Bold with linear main strokes that shift between rounded curves and straight edges, giving individual letters a tense, deliberate character. Three stylistic sets and a contextual alternates randomiser provide considerable variation within a single setting, covering uppercase and lowercase forms as well as alternate figures. Diacritics are deliberately thin and wide, contrasting with the more substantial letterforms to keep extended Latin text legible across a broad language range.
Classification
Blow features linear main strokes with soft curves alternating against strong straight lines, giving it a geometric character with expressive personality. Its structured construction and clean architecture place it firmly in the geometric sans tradition.
